Ubuntu 15.04 с intel_pstate - частота низких токов

Есть еще одна причина задержки при переключении раскладки клавиатуры. В соответствии с выпуском № 1370953 (и № 1370953) такое поведение может быть связано с плохой производительностью диска. См. Комментарий Максима Кравец:

Каждое изменение макета чередует файл ~ / .config / dconf / user. Изменение формата происходит медленно, когда диск занят.

Существует одна вещь (не только одна) для перехода по проблеме диска - для изменения планировщика очереди дисков. По умолчанию Ubuntu настроен на использование планировщика крайних сроков, для медленного жесткого диска лучше использовать cfq scheduler.

См. # 1370953 .

1
задан 13 April 2017 в 15:23

3 ответа

Это может быть связано с ограничением частоты в частоте процессора. Чтобы решить эту проблему 14.04 и 16.04, мне пришлось сделать следующее:

Open grub:

sudo vim /etc/default/grub

Заменить строку GRUB_CMDLINE_LINUX_DEFAULT:

- G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
+ GRUB_CMDLINE_LINUX_DEFAULT="quiet splash intel_pstate=disable processor.ignore_ppc=1"
[d3 ] Обновить grub:

sudo update-grub

Перезагрузка затем:

echo 1 | sudo dd of=/sys/module/processor/parameters/ignore_ppc
echo 2900000 | sudo dd of=/sys/devices/system/cpu/cpu0/cpufreq/scaling_max_freq 
echo 2900000 | sudo dd of=/sys/devices/system/cpu/cpu1/cpufreq/scaling_max_freq 
echo 2900000 | sudo dd of=/sys/devices/system/cpu/cpu2/cpufreq/scaling_max_freq 
echo 2900000 | sudo dd of=/sys/devices/system/cpu/cpu3/cpufreq/scaling_max_freq 

Работала для меня. Проверьте количество ядер процессора и обновите их соответствующим образом. Вы можете поместить эти дополнительные строки в /etc/rc.local, чтобы они выполнялись при каждой загрузке.

Редактирование ниндзя: замените 2900000 выше значением в:

cat /sys/devices/system/cpu/cpu0/cpufreq/cpuinfo_max_freq
1
ответ дан 23 May 2018 в 17:36

У меня была аналогичная проблема с Ubuntu 14.04.3 с использованием стека включения LTS для Vivid.

После разрыва моих волос около недели я выяснил, что это было потому, что у меня был intel-microcode установлен , кажется, что он конфликтует с ядром 3.19.

Как только я удалил его, проблема исчезла.

0
ответ дан 23 May 2018 в 17:36

Skylake все еще разрабатывается, как показывают тесты Phoronix, но Kernel 4.2 и выше идут хорошо, поэтому я предлагаю вам установить это из mainline ppa.

0
ответ дан 23 May 2018 в 17:36

Другие вопросы по тегам:

Похожие вопросы: